The Evaluation Of Acute Myocardial Infarction Clinical Pathways Of Integrated Traditional Chinese And Western Medicine

ObjectivesTo evaluation of acute myocardial infarction clinical pathways of integrated traditional chinese and western medicine.MethodsThrough the multicenter study approach, the study select the patients whom the first diagnosed as "acute myocardial infarction" be in hospitalized in ICU of Guangdong Provincial Hospital of TCM and the other centers'from January 2008 to December 2009 as non-clinical pathway group, and the patients whom the first diagnosed as "acute myocardial infarction" be in hospitalized in ICU of Guangdong Provincial Hospital of TCM and the other centers'from September 2009 to Octorber 2010 as clinical pathway group (the patients' selection starts from September 2009, other centers'starts form January 2010), compared with two groups of hospitalized patients with major relevant circumstances. The main evaluation indicators:such as length of stay, hospital costs, hospital incidence of major cardiovascular events, and so on.ResultThe study collects 602 cases in line with the inclusion criteria, including The clinical pathway group of 197 cases, and the non-clinical group of 405 cases. The total length of stay from 12.7±8.6 days down to 9.2±4.2 days (P<0.01), the total hospitalization cost decreased from 52866.0 yuan to 46365.7 yuan (P<0.01). There was a downward trend of Hospital mortality rate declining from 5.4% to 1.5%(P<0.05) ConclusionThe acute myocardial infarction clinical pathways of integrated traditional chinese and western medicine can safely reduce the total length of hospitalization stay and the total hospitalization cost.
